Introduction
Framepack ai is an open-source AI video generation platform that creates full-length 30 fps videos on laptops with minimal VRAM requirements.
What is Framepack ai?
Framepack ai is an innovative open-source platform designed to generate AI-powered videos from still images. This tool addresses the significant challenge of high computational requirements typically associated with AI video generation, making the technology accessible to users with standard hardware. The platform enables creators to produce smooth, full-length videos at 30 frames per second using laptops and desktops with as little as 6 GB VRAM. By democratizing AI video creation, Framepack ai serves content creators, researchers, and studios who need professional-quality video output without investing in expensive rendering infrastructure or high-end graphics cards.
Key Features of Framepack ai
Low VRAM Requirements
Framepack ai generates high-quality videos with just 6GB of VRAM, making AI video generation accessible for laptop users and those with budget-friendly graphics cards.
Full-Length 30 FPS Videos
The platform creates smooth, professional-quality videos at 30 frames per second with durations extending up to 60 seconds, providing substantial content from single images.
Open Source & Extensible
Built on a modular Python codebase, Framepack ai offers complete transparency and customization options for developers and researchers wanting to extend its capabilities.
Optimized Performance
With processing speeds of approximately 2.5 seconds per frame on RTX 4090 (and 1.5 seconds with optimizations), the platform delivers proportionally efficient performance across various hardware configurations.
High-Quality Output
Framepack ai produces professional-grade videos with consistent visual style and smooth transitions between frames, maintaining quality throughout the generated content.
Cross-Platform Support
The software is fully supported on Linux systems, with a convenient one-click Windows package currently in development for broader accessibility.

How to Use Framepack ai
Getting started with Framepack ai involves a straightforward installation and setup process. First, ensure you have an independent Python 3.10 environment configured on your system. Install the required dependencies using pip commands, including torch, torchvision, and torchaudio from the specified PyTorch index URL. After installing the framework requirements, launch the graphical interface by running the demo_gradio.py script, which supports various parameters including --share, --port, and --server options for customization.
The platform supports multiple attention mechanisms including PyTorch attention, xformers, flash-attn, and sage-attention, with PyTorch attention enabled by default. For optimal prompt engineering, users can employ a specific ChatGPT template to generate motion-focused prompts that describe visual elements like human activity, moving objects, or camera movements. Effective prompts typically follow the structure of subject description, followed by motion description, then additional details, prioritizing dynamic movements over subtle ones for best results.

Is Framepack ai Free?
Framepack ai is completely free and open-source, available under the MIT license that allows for both personal and commercial use without restrictions. The platform's source code is publicly accessible on GitHub, enabling users to download, modify, and distribute the software according to their needs. Frequently Asked Questions about Framepack ai
What are the minimum system requirements for Framepack ai?
Framepack ai requires a GPU with at least 6 GB VRAM, Python 3.10 environment, and compatible with Linux operating systems, with Windows support coming soon.
How long does it take to generate a 60-second video?
Generation time varies by hardware, but on an RTX 3060 6GB laptop, FramePack can produce 60-second videos (1800 frames) with the 13B HY variant model.
Can Framepack ai be used for commercial projects?
Yes, as an open-source platform under MIT license, Framepack ai can be used for both personal and commercial projects without restrictions or licensing fees.
What types of motion work best with Framepack ai prompts?
Dynamic, larger movements like dancing, jumping, or running typically produce better results than subtle motions, with prompts structured as subject description followed by motion description.
Does Framepack ai support custom models or extensions?
The modular Python codebase is designed specifically for extensibility, allowing researchers and developers to implement custom models and experiment with new video diffusion techniques.
What attention mechanisms does Framepack ai support?
The platform supports PyTorch attention (default), xformers, flash-attn, and sage-attention, though users are recommended to try the default option first before experimenting with alternatives.
